In a new Reason Rupe Poll, Americans were asked if they think only kids who win things should get trophies, or if every kid should get a trophy and the majority, 57% of us say only winners deserve trophies.

However, it looks as though the majority of those who supported trophies for only winners were clearly older, more educated and affluent.

The more money you make, the more likely you are to think only winners should get trophies.

The more education you have, the more likely you are to think only winners should get trophies.

And the older you are, the more likely you are to think only winners should get trophies.
